Why Spring Is the Right Period for Floor Repair in Campbell



Campbell sits in the heart of Silicon Valley, where the climate is moderate yet not static. Winter season bring boosted moisture from seasonal rains, and that moisture works its means right into timber grain, causing mild growth. Then dry summertime heat arrives and draws that dampness out, causing tightening. This cycle of development and tightening is hard on hardwood floorings gradually.



Spring sits in the pleasant place between these two extremes. Moisture levels in Campbell throughout March with May tend to be modest and constant, which implies timber remains in a relatively stable state. When floorings are sanded and redecorated throughout this home window, the finish bonds extra uniformly and cures extra naturally than it would in the middle of a completely dry August or a wet January.

Reading Your Floors Prior To You Beginning



Before calling in an expert or picking up a sander, require time to actually examine what your floorings need. Not every worn flooring requires a full refinish. Go through your home in excellent lighting and note where the surface looks damaged versus where the wood itself appears harmed. Drag your fingernail lightly throughout a dull area. If the surface smears or flakes, the surface area covering is falling short. If the timber underneath looks gray or dark, moisture damage may have reached deeper right into the grain.



In Campbell homes, moisture-related wear often concentrates near entrances encountering west or south, where afternoon sunlight drives temperature level swings, and near gliding glass doors leading to outdoor patios and yard amusing spaces. Animals, youngsters, and energetic lifestyles are a truth below, and high-traffic areas near the cooking area and living-room often tend to reveal one of the most put on.



Comprehending the nature of your floor's damage assists you have a much more educated conversation with a flooring expert and guarantees the best remediation method gets applied.



The Distinction Between a Screen-and-Recoat and a Complete Sand-Down



Among one of the most typical concerns house owners ask is whether their floors need a light refresh or a complete overhaul. The answer depends upon exactly how far the damages has actually penetrated.



A screen-and-recoat involves gently abrading the existing completed with a buffer and applying a fresh topcoat. This functions well when the surface has actually dulled or established surface scratches but the wood itself stays intact. It's less invasive, faster, and more economical, and it extends the life of a floor that still has structural stability.



A full sand-down, which is what many people picture when they think of hardwood floor restoration, includes removing the existing finish totally by fining sand to bare wood. This method addresses deeper scrapes, discolorations, deformed boards, and coating that has actually used through entirely. It takes even more time and needs the space to be left during job and for a duration later while the surface remedies, but it creates remarkable results.



For a hardwood wood floor refinishing service, experienced professionals will evaluate your floor's thickness, the number of times it has formerly been fined sand, and the degree of the damage before recommending the best course forward. Pushing for a complete refinish when a recoat will do wastes cash. Picking a recoat when the damages is unfathomable bring about disappointing results.



Preparing Your Home for the Repair Process



Excellent prep work prior to the job begins makes the whole job go a lot more efficiently. Beginning by eliminating all furniture from the spaces being dealt with. Even things you assume may be out of the way can create barriers for tools and need to move at some point.



Dirt is a considerable worry during fining sand. Although modern-day flooring sanding tools utilizes containment systems, great particles still travel. Covering heating and cooling vents in the workplace, getting rid of art and soft furnishings from surrounding spaces, and sealing entrances with plastic sheeting all help have the mess.



If you have family pets, schedule them to remain somewhere else throughout the work and for at the very least 24 to two days after the last layer is applied. Pets, specifically canines, are notorious for strolling across fresh ended up floors and leaving paw prints that set completely into the coating.

Picking the Right Complete for Bay Location Living



Not all floor ends up do the same way in every environment, and the Bay Area's details conditions should educate your choice. Oil-based polyurethane coatings provide extraordinary resilience and a cozy amber tone that lots of homeowners enjoy, but they take longer to treat and generate strong fumes during application. Water-based coatings dry quicker, produce less VOCs, and keep a clearer appearance that lets the all-natural grain represent itself.



For houses in Campbell with children, animals, or a hectic way of living, surface area solidity issues. Ask your floor covering professional about the shine level also. High-gloss coatings reveal every spot and impact in a way that satin and matte options do not. Provided how much all-natural light streams with Bay Location homes, a lower shine typically produces an extra comfy, habitable appearance while still securing the wood successfully.



Caring for Your Floors After Remediation



The weeks promptly complying with a refinish are vital. Avoid wet-mopping for at least 2 weeks after the final coat, and make use of only cleansers especially created for finished wood floors. Rug must remain off the flooring for at least a month to permit the surface to totally solidify.

Maintaining a consistent interior humidity degree year-round, ideally between 35 and 55 percent, is one of the most reliable methods to stop premature wear and lower the frequency of redecorating cycles.



Easy behaviors make a significant distinction. Placing felt pads under furnishings legs, establishing a no-shoes policy inside the home, and sweeping or dry-mopping regularly all secure your financial investment long after the remediation team read here has actually left and left.



When to Call a Specialist



DIY floor refinishing sets exist, and they function sensibly well for very little repair services or touch-ups in low-visibility places. For anything more substantial, nevertheless, the danger of unequal sanding, lap marks in the coating, or getting rid of way too much product from the timber surface area makes specialist aid worth the price.



An experienced floor restoration professional brings not just equipment but adjusted judgment. Recognizing just how much material to get rid of, just how to mix fixed sections into the bordering floor, and just how to apply coating in such a way that remedies equally throughout a huge area originates from experience that no weekend break project can reproduce.
